Price in Lake George Park is driven by condition and structure, not by a tidy tier of comparable homes. With a housing stock spanning from 1920 to 2024 and a median build year around 1970, this is a mixed-vintage pocket where a renovated older home and a tired one of the same footprint can trade far apart. The median living area sits near 1,186 square feet, so you are largely shopping compact homes where updates and mechanical condition swing value more than square footage.
For buyers, that spread is the opportunity: do your homework on roof, systems, and permit history, and there is room to buy well. For sellers, it means presentation and honest condition disclosure matter more here than in a uniform subdivision — a well-kept home separates itself from the older, deferred-maintenance inventory quickly, while an as-is listing gets priced against it. With a homestead share around 42 percent, a meaningful portion of this market is non-owner-occupied, which tends to keep a steady flow of rental and investor-grade product moving through.

The market around Lake George Park
Lake George Park is a small community — 34 recorded sales on file, most recently in 2026 — too few for its own price trend. Here is the market around it.
Across Pasco County, 4,307 homes are active and 1,258 pending (23% under contract).
The housing mix here is 79% single family residence, 16% manufactured home - post 1977, 3% mobile home - pre 1976.
ZIP and county figures describe the wider market, not Lake George Park specifically. Momentum Research analysis of MLS records.

A mixed-vintage pocket, not a subdivision
The defining feature here is age range. Homes date as far back as 1920 and as recently as 2024, with the middle of the pack landing around 1970. That means no two blocks read the same, and no single comp set covers the community. Expect original-era construction sitting near infill and full renovations, and price your expectations to the specific house in front of you.
At roughly 1,186 square feet median, these are efficient homes rather than sprawling ones. That footprint rewards buyers who want a manageable property and rewards sellers who have invested in kitchens, baths, and mechanicals. With 248 homes and a homestead share near 42 percent, there is a real rental and investment presence alongside owner-occupants, so both use cases are on the table.
